Snacks with Dairy: Tomato & Cheese Salsa w/ Cornbread Crisps
Looking for delicious, quick snacks with dairy for a flavor bump? Fresh, colorful, and full of summer flavor, juicy heirloom tomatoes are combined with red onion, cilantro, lime juice, and crumbled queso fresco for a creamy, tangy finish. Serve alongside crispy cornbread for a uniquely Southern twist.

PREP TIME: 15 minutes
COOK TIME: 10 minutes
SERVINGS: 6
TOTAL TIME: 25 minutes
Ingredients
Salsa:
2 cups diced heirloom tomatoes
1/4 cup red onion, diced
1/4 cup cilantro, chopped
1/2 teaspoon cumin
Juice of 1 lime
Pinch of salt
1/2 cup queso fresco, crumbled
Cornbread Crisps:
Slices of leftover cornbread, cut into small pieces
Olive oil for brushing
Sea salt

Instructions
Mix all salsa ingredients together, folding in cheese last.
Brush cornbread slices with oil and toast in the oven or air fryer until crisp.
Serve salsa in a wide bowl surrounded by crisps.
